The number currently linked to Steven is (281) 575-8565. In addition to Houston, Steven also lived in Houston. Records link Steven with Ann Marie Lunsford, Barbara F Ford, Anna Lunsford and one other person. 1954 is the birth year of Steven. Steven has reached the age of 70 years. Steven currently resides at 12310 Pine Knoll Dr, Houston, Tx 77099.
English is Steven's ethnicity. Western European is his ethnic group. English is the language Steven can speak. Steven's education level is college. Steven was born on 1954-02-14.